1) Amazone river - Drains 2.7 million square miles - 6437 km - The largest - Provides a transportation 2) Magdalena - Flow between cordilleras in Colombia and empty into the Caribbean Sea 3) Orinoco - Drains the Lanos of central Venezuela and the Guiana Highlands. 4) Sao Francisco river - Drains the Brazilian Highlands to the east 5) Rio de la Plata - Actually an estuary

A peculiarity of the Orinoco river system is the Casiquiare canal, which starts as an arm of the Orinoco, and finds its way to the Rio Negro, a tributary of the Amazon, thus forming a 'natural canal' between Orinoco and Amazon.
